Text us or call us on : 011 33 20 30 40

Account Login





Lost password?
Signup now
aql Telecoms

Click here to view aql's range of voice fax and Business Voice over IP telephony solutions.
Click Here...

Developers

service icon

3 UK Network - 3G Data Coverage API

This API is used to check 3 UK Network 3G data coverage information using postcode.


Charges

This API is free for everyone, all you need to have is an account with aql. Please contact us or fill in our free trial form to obtain an account.


Connection Details

The 3 coverage API is available via our HTTP POST interface:

https://gw.aql.com/three/data_coverage.api.php (or http)

Although we do offer the standard HTTP gateway, we do prefer that your application uses the HTTPS gateway as it prevents sensitive details being “sniffed” across the internet.


Gateway Parameters

The gateway expects the following parameters:

Parameter NamePresenceValues
usernamemandatoryYour aql username
passwordmandatoryYour aql password
postcodemandatoryThe postcode to lookup. In a whitespace-less format, eg: LS101JQ

Gateway Return Values

On success, the gateway will return the following parameters

Parameter NameValue Description
status200
descOK
postcodeFormatted postcode from the query parameter by removing all whitespace characters.
congestion Congestion band category. Possible values:
  • Blue: no congestion area.
  • Green: insignificant congestion area.
  • Amber: congested area.
  • Red: heavily congested area.
indoor_type Indicate if an area has a good indoor/outdoor coverage. Possible values:
  • out-and-indoor: coverage available outdoor and indoor
  • outdoor-only: coverage is available outdoor only.

The default format of the retuned data is:

<status>: <description>. <postcode>: <congestion> - <indoor_type>

where the items in angle brackets will be replaced with their actual values.

If the return-mode or return-format parameters are set in the original request, the returned string will be different depending on the format you choose.


Gateway Error Values

If the call was not successful, the gateway will return the following parameters

Parameter NameValue description
statusStatus code for the type of error (see Below)
descA string with a short description of the error

The format of the retuned data is:

<status>: <desc>

where the items in brackets will be replaced with their actual values.

If the return-mode parameter is set to 'url', the format of the returned data will be different. See below for details.

Status Codes

Status CodeDescription
200OK
401Authentication error
6200Invalid postcode parameter
6201No coverage data available

Note: *status code 6201 means 3UK 3G Data coverage databases do not contain any information on this particular postcode.

You can view the return-mode and return-format descriptions here.

Quick Links

Latest News


KPMG appointed as auditors for aql

As a growing company, aql have a strong desire to achieve our long term expansion plan and In...

Read More

UK Network Operators’ Forum

The United Kingdom Network Operators’ Forum (UKNOF) relies completely on sponsors and volunteers...

Read More

North Pole Trek

aql sponsored businessman turned adventurer, Geoff Major, as part of his charity challenge of a...

Read More

Janet Networkshop 2012 event, York

The annual Janet Networkshop event took place this week between 3rd and 5th April 2012,...

Read More

RIPE NCC event

Dr Adam Beaumont will be representing aql at RIPE (64) NCC meeting to be held in Ljubljana,...

Read More